Two weeks ago I posted the message below (at the user list) but did not get any suggestions. Today I did some tests and found a more specific problem. The behaviour only occurs when I "centroid fill" a polygon layer as ellipses. When I transform my polygons to points in PostGIS and create data defined ellipses on those points in QGIS, I get what I expect. So this seems to be some kind of bug.

By the way, a very helpful feature for drawing data defined ellipses would be a "scale" option since it's a small chance that your data values match the ellipse size in pixels. And for cartographic reasons you want to "play" a little with these sizes to get a good looking map.

> For a research project I need to draw ellipses on top of a polygon map
> based on a width and height field in my table. I was really happy to
> find out that QGIS has this functionality. Unfortunately I don't get it
> to work.
>
> I managed to draw the polygons and draw ellipses on top of them, using
> two rules (rule based symbology). I use the "centroid fill" with an
> "ellipse marker". The marker initially has a fixed size (4x3) but I like
> to set these by two fields in the "data defined settings" tab. I can
> choose the fields, but their values do not overrule the 4x3 standard
> settings.
>
> Can anybody verify this behaviour or tell me what I'm doing wrong?
